Job description
Payroll Officer job vacancy in Maitland, Cape Town.

Our Technology manufacturing client is looking for a Payroll Officer with 5 years plus experience which will be responsible for managing the payroll process, ensuring accurate and timely payment of salaries, and compliance with all relevant legislation and company policies.

The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of payroll systems, tax regulations, and employee benefits.

Salary plus benefits.

Minimum Qualifications and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ree / Diploma in Finance, Accounting, Human Resources,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in payroll processing, preferably in South Africa.
  • Strong knowledge of South African payroll legislation and tax regulations.
  • Proficiency in payroll software (e.g., Sage, Pastel, VIP) and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Experience with HRIS systems.
  • Knowledge of employee benefits and compensation structures.
  • Certification in payroll management (e.g., SAPA, IPM) is an advantage.
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Payroll Processing – Prepare and process the monthly payroll for all employees, ensuring accuracy and compliance with company policies and legal requirements.
  • Calculate salaries, deductions, bonuses, and overtime, ensuring all entries are accurate and timely.
  • Compliance – Ensure compliance with South African labor laws, tax regulations, and other statutory requirements related to payroll.
  • Record Keeping – Maintain accurate payroll records, including employee information, pay rates, and deductions.
  • Prepare and maintain payroll reports for management and auditing purposes.
  • Employee Support – Address employee inquiries regarding payroll, deductions, and benefits.
  • Reconciliation – Reconcile payroll accounts and resolve discrepancies in a timely manner.
  • System Management – manage and maintain the payroll software/system, ensuring data integrity and security.
  • Tax Reporting – Prepare and submit all necessary tax returns and reports to the South African Revenue Service (SARS) and other relevant authorities.
  • Ensure that all payroll taxes are calculated and paid on time.
